The filesystem on my Mother's Mac has a directory inconsistency that I
would like to repair for her. The disk optimizer from Sum II gives up
with an error "D 5" and Disk First Aid complains it cannot repair
the disk. She's gotten these messages from SUM II Recover:

	1) SCSI - Okay
	2) Volume Information Block - Okay
	3) Directory is bad
	   Number of files does not match MDB
	   Allocation map is invalid.

Aside from the inability to optimize the disk or repair it with Disk First Aid,
there are no other symptoms or problems. All of her files seem readable.

Is there any way to repair the disk by editing with SUM II Tools?  Can I
use some other FSDB-like tool?  Since she must backup, initialize and reload
all of her files to recover, I'm willing to take a stab at patching things
by hand.
